What is an Accident Injury Lawsuit?
An accident injury lawsuit is a legal claim filed by an individual (the complainant) who has actually suffered injuries due to the negligence or wrongful act of another party (the offender). The primary goal of such claims is to obtain compensation for damages incurred, which may consist of medical expenditures, lost incomes, pain and suffering, and other losses.

Q1: How long do I have to submit a lawsuit after an accident?
A: The time limitation to submit a lawsuit varies by state due to statutes of limitations. Generally, it ranges from one to 3 years from the date of the accident. It is a good idea to consult a lawyer immediately.
Q2: What should I do immediately after an accident?
A: Seek medical attention, record the accident scene, collect witness details, and get in touch with a lawyer before speaking to insurance agents.
Q3: How is compensation figured out in an injury lawsuit?
A: Compensation is determined based on elements such as medical expenses, lost earnings, discomfort and suffering, and the degree of carelessness shown by the offender.
Q4: Will my case go to trial?
A: Most personal injury cases are settled before reaching trial. Nevertheless, if a fair settlement can not be reached, the case may proceed to court.
Q5: How much will a lawyer expense?
A: Many accident injury lawyers deal with a contingency cost basis, meaning they only receive payment if you win your case. Their fees typically vary from 25% to 40% of the awarded compensation.
